Boost your weight loss journey with this strawberry banana smoothie. Packed with fiber, antioxidants, and protein, it’s a delicious choice.

  • Total Time: 5 minutes
  • Yield: 1 1x

Ingredients

Units Scale
  • 1 cup frozen strawberries
  • 1/2 cup frozen banana chunks
  • 1/2 cup Greek yogurt (unsweetened)
  • 1 tbsp chia seeds
  • 1/3 cup almond milk (unsweetened)

Instructions

  1. Measure the ingredients carefully.
  2. Add all the ingredients to a high-speed blender starting with the frozen fruit and spinach. Blitz until smooth. For about 4-5 minutes.
  3. Serve and enjoy!

Notes

Best consumed straight away, however, you can take it with you and drink it on the go!

Nutrition

  • Serving Size: 1 smoothie
  • Calories: 266
  • Sugar: 14.6
  • Fat: 7.9g
  • Carbohydrates: 31.7g
  • Fiber: 8.7g
  • Protein: 12.2g

General Benefits of Drinking Strawberry Banana Smoothie

Strawberry Banana Weight Loss Smoothie served in a tall thin glass cup

Weight loss isn’t the only benefit you get from drinking a strawberry banana smoothie with yogurt for weight loss.

The smoothie offers so much more.

Here’s a breakdown of some of the benefits:

  • Rich in Antioxidants: Antioxidants help combat oxidative stress and cell damage.
  • High in Dietary Fiber: Supports digestion and can promote feelings of fullness.
  • Aids in Muscle Repair & Growth:  And overall body function. This is thanks to the protein content present in this shake.
  • Boosts The Immune System: The smoothie contains vitamins like vitamin C and A, which help bolster the immune response.
  • Bone Health: The use of Greek yogurt in this smoothie offers calcium and vitamin D, important for bone density and growth.
  • Promotes Heart Health: I used chia seeds, which contain omega-3s. Omega-3s can support cardiovascular health.
  • Energy Boost: The presence of a mix of macronutrients gives sustained energy throughout the day.
  • Anti-Inflammatory: The banana berry smoothie contains compounds that may help reduce inflammation in the body.

Options To Customize This Smoothie

Strawberry Banana Weight Loss Smoothie

You can easily customize this smoothie to suit your taste and preferences. 

Below are some options I recommend, alternatively, you can choose for yourself!

  1. Vegan-Friendly: For a dairy-free smoothie, swap the dairy yogurt for a vegan alternative or 1 avocado.
  2. Boost The Protein: Add a scoop of protein powder for extra protein.
  3. Seeds For Nut Butter: You can swap the chia seeds for a tablespoon of nut butter instead.
  4. Swap The Base: Instead of almond milk, use unsweetened oat or soy milk.
